A leading manufacturing business in South Wales is seeking an experienced Quality Manager. This key leadership role is responsible for maintaining high standards and supporting continuous improvement activities throughout manufacturing operations.

The Quality Manager will take ownership of the quality function, providing guidance, support, and leadership across the business. Responsibilities include:

  • Leading and maintaining the site's quality systems and procedures.
  • Planning and conducting internal audits and supporting external assessments.
  • Investigating quality concerns and implementing effective corrective actions.
  • Analysing performance data and identifying areas for improvement.
  • Working closely with Production, Engineering, and Operations teams.
  • Supporting customer and supplier quality activities.
  • Driving continuous improvement initiatives across the business.
  • Maintaining inspection and measurement systems.
  • Producing quality reports and monitoring key performance indicators.
  • Promoting best practice throughout manufacturing operations.
  • Developing and supporting members of the quality team.
  • Assisting with the introduction of new products and manufacturing processes.
  • Ensuring compliance with relevant standards and customer requirements.

Experience needed:

  • Previous experience within a Quality Manager role in manufacturing.
  • Strong understanding of quality systems and auditing activities.
  • Experience investigating root causes and implementing corrective actions.
  • Ability to interpret data and drive improvements.
  • Strong communication and leadership skills.
  • Hands-on approach with the ability to influence at all levels.
  • Customer-focused mindset.

Desirable:

  • Knowledge of APQP and PPAP processes.
  • Experience with statistical process control techniques.
  • Lean Manufacturing or Six Sigma exposure.
  • Experience supporting new product introduction activities.
